Jose is 52 inches tall and is growing 0.25 inches each month.
 Jacob is 54 inches tall and is growing 0.1 inches each month.
 How many months, x, will it take for Jose to be the same height as Jacob?

.25x + 52 = .1x + 54
.25x - .1x = 54 - 52
.15x = 2
x = 2/.15
x = 13{{{1/3}}} months

Check this, find the actual height when they are same
52 + 13.33(.25) = 55.33 inches
54 + 13.33(.1) = 55.33
